Why Battery Container Partnerships Are Electrifying Industries

Think of these agreements as corporate matchmaking for the climate era. Unlike traditional power purchase deals, these partnerships focus on modular, scalable energy storage that adapts faster than a chameleon at a rainbow convention. The global energy storage container market is projected to balloon from $2.1 billion in 2023 to $8.9 billion by 2028 (Grand View Research), proving that companies aren’t just dipping toes – they’re doing cannonballs into this pool of potential.

Three Shockingly Effective Collaboration Models

  • The Joint Venture Jolt: Like the recent Siemens-ESMIT partnership in Chile, merging German engineering with local grid expertise
  • Container-as-a-Service (CaaS): Enel X’s pay-per-use model that powered 45 factories in Italy last summer during peak demand
  • Emergency Power Pacts: Southern California Edison’s mobile container network that saved 12,000+ homes during 2022 wildfires

Case Study: When Tesla Met PG&E – A Grid Romance for the Ages

Remember when Pacific Gas & Electric needed to replace a gas peaker plant faster than you can say “climate emergency”? Their cooperation agreement with Tesla deployed 76 battery containers across 3 counties in 11 months flat – a project that normally takes 3+ years. The result? A 230 MW/920 MWh system that’s become the blueprint for rapid grid-scale deployments.

Navigating the Minefield: Pro Tips for Successful Deals

While drafting your energy storage battery container cooperation agreement, avoid these rookie mistakes:

  • Overlooking local fire codes (lithium-ion isn’t a fan of surprises)
  • Ignoring “energy stacking” opportunities – why settle for one revenue stream when you can have five?
  • Forgetting about thermal management – nobody wants a melted battery on their hands
